Stone post by the A3075, in parish of St Newlyn East (Carrick District), West end of village, on crossroads verge. Inscription reads:- : {arrow-?} / NEWLYN / ---- / CUBERT / {<-arrow} : : {arrow-?} / NEWQUAY / TREVEMPER / BRIDGE : Grade II listed. List Entry Number: 1141569 https://historicengland.org.uk/listing/the-list/list-entry/1141569 Surveyed Milestone Society National ID: CW_XSTN1
